The seminal vesicle contributes the majority of the fluid volume of the ejaculate. Seminal vesicle secretions are rich in fructose and prostaglandins. While fructose may be an important energy source for spermatozoa, the role of prostaglandins is unknown. The seminal vesicle also produces several androgen-dependent secretory proteins that are involved in the rapid clotting of the ejaculate (http://www.andrologysociety.com/resources/handbook/ch.1.asp).
